


The third season of I Think You Should Leave has arrived and with it, a new anthem that might make you wake up, move your head all around and realize that there just might be no rules. The song appears in the final sketch of the fourth episode and caps off the new friendship of a sartorially connected duo (played by Biff Wiff and Tim Robinson).
Written by Brendan Yates, Pat McCrory, Daniel Fang and Franz Lyons (members of Turnstile, who’s currently on tour with blink-182), “Listening” is an original song that might get you all f**ked up, and make you want to do everything in your power to never do anything that’s a rule again.
